Raritan KX232
The 32-port, 2-digital user DKX232 allows KVM over IP BIOS-level access to 32 computers and network devices controlled by a Web Browser from any location. Installation is simple with the KX232 1U KVM over IP solution which also features high-quality video, an industry-leading security gateway for all remote users, and integrated remote power control for total cold-reboot management. Multi-platform browser access to the Dominion KX232 can be established from a number of programs including Windows, Linux, Sun or Mac. Fail-safe right of entry into the KX232 is granted through a built-in Modem which allows remote access whenever your network or the internet is down. Centralized multiple remote computer management is also made simple by integrating Raritan’s CommandCenter for a single and secure IP gateway for all KX232 attached devices.

Dominion KX an enterprise-class, secure, digital KVM appliance that combines analog switching with the industry's highest-performing KVM Over IP (remote access) technology.

At the rack, Dominion KX provides BIOS-level control of up to 32 servers and other IT devices from a single keyboard, monitor, and mouse. Plus, Dominion KX's integrated remote access capabilities provide the same BIOS-level control of your servers, from anywhere in the world, via Web browser or modem.

Dominion KX is easily installed in minutes using standard UTP (Cat5/5e/6) cabling. Its advanced features, including 128-bit encryption; remote power control; dual Ethernet ports; LDAP, RADIUS, Active Directory, syslog integration; and Web management, enable you to deliver higher uptime, better productivity, and bulletproof security – at anytime from anywhere.

Raritan KX232 Features and Benefits

Raritan KX232 Hardware

  • Multiple hardware models enable simultaneous IP access by 1 or 2 remote users.

  • Dominion KX provides KVM over IP control of 32 servers.

  • Employs Raritan's next generation KVM over IP technology with advanced video resolution detection hardware. When a user switches between servers, this system automatically transitions to the new video source quickly and accurately. 

  • Simple deployment - Dominion KX connects to each server via standard, economical Cat5 (UTP) cabling. Servers may be located as far as 50 cable feet from the Dominion KX unit.

  • A sophisticated, new product look featuring an ergonomic design and new blue LED indicators for clear, easy-to-see power, network activity and user activity.

  • Extremely rack-efficient - only 1U in height.

  • New smaller form-factor CIMs, available for PS/2, USB, Sun and Sun USB, allow cabling distances of up to 50 feet.

  • All Dominion KX models have an integrated modem port, for emergency remote access if the data network is unavailable.

Raritan KX232 Connectivity

  • Dominion KX provides BIOS-level, IP access to 1 or 2 simultaneous, remote users. This is achieved while allowing full, un-blocked local console access and control.

  • Extends Raritan's award-winning IP-Reach video compression technology, the industry's highest-performing KVM Over IP technology. Users can access Dominion KX from anywhere on the network (LAN, WAN, Internet, dial-up), allowing administrators to troubleshoot, reconfigure, reboot and even power cycle servers remotely.

  • Features a local port for non-blocking, at-the-rack access. From this console, Dominion KX behaves like a traditional KVM switch, giving users direct access and control of the connected servers. For additional flexibility, Dominion KX provides both PS/2 and USB local ports.

  • Users can power up, power down or power cycle servers connected to optional Raritan Remote Power Control units. A system administrator can not only troubleshoot a server remotely, but also power cycle that server with a few clicks of the mouse.

  • Provides high-availability with dual Ethernet ports for redundancy. Should one Ethernet switch or interface card fail, Dominion KX will automatically failover to the other port and continue operating.

Raritan KX232 Software

  • Dominion KX is a completely self-contained system (i.e. an appliance). All features, including authentication and Web-access, are built into the unit and do not require the use of additional servers.

  • Users can access Dominion KX thru a standard Web browser. This eliminates the need to install a proprietary software "client" on the user's desktop.

  • Improves upon Raritan's award-winning KVM Over IP technology with the introduction of 15-bit color support (32,000 colors), enabling higher video quality. Multiple colors modes, as well as greyscale are available to connect via modem or low bandwidth link.

  • Up to 2 users can each connect remotely and access the same server. This is very useful for teamed troubleshooting and collaboration.

  • Video performance is automatically configured to match the available network bandwidth. With high speed LAN access, more bandwidth is available and higher quality video information can be sent —resulting in better performance. When accessing via dial-up modem, very little bandwidth is available, so Dominion KX adapts to provide effective response. Users can also manually configure if desired.

Raritan KX232 Security

  • Incorporates 128-bit SSL encryption to ensure that customer server environments are protected from malicious hackers.

  • Securely encrypts the video stream in addition to keyboard and mouse data.

  • Integrates with industry-standard directory servers, such as Active Directory, via LDAP or RADIUS protocols. Allows Dominion KX to integrate with pre-existing username/password databases for security.

  • Dominion KX offers many additional security features including strong password checking, access control lists, inactivity timers, private device keys, group permissions, etc.

Raritan KX232 Management

  • Administrators can remotely perform all management, administration and configuration operations using a simple graphical user interface, at the convenience of their desktop.

  • Complete integration with Raritan's CommandCenter, allowing enterprise users to consolidate all Dominion devices into a single logical system, with a single IP address, and a single management interface.

  • Firmware upgrades can be downloaded directly from the Raritan Web site and upgrades can be performed via the network.

  • Event and access logging. Allows logging capabilities to be centralized in one syslog server (a standard event logging system).

Raritan KX232 Specifications
 

  Raritan KX232
(32 Server Ports, 2 Remote User, 1 Local Port for Rack Use)
  Dimensions: 17.3" (W) x 11.4" (D) x 1.75" (H)
439mm (W) x 290mm (D) x 44mm (H)
  Weight: 8.65lbs / (3.9 kg)
  Power: 100V/240V 50/60Hz 0.6A
  Form Factor: 1U, full width, rack mountable (brackets included)
  Operating Temperature: 32° (0°C) to 104° (40°C)
  Remote Connection  
  Network: Dual Failover 10/100 Ethernet (RJ45)
  Modem Port: DB9(F) DTE
  Protocols: TCP/IP, HTTP, HTTPS, UDP, RADIUS, LDAP(S), SNTP, DHCP, PAP, CHAP
